If after 5 days she hasnt popped, definitely feel ok to gently take a peak under the piece of pod cover you put in place and see if shes tangled up or sprouted. If not cover her back up, she may require longer.
I personally have had them pop on day 3 and everything up to day 10. After 10 days, I throw them out and start over.

Let’s push your pod up to about an inch above the line. This is the stage where we can prevent damping off by raising the coco pod to ensure its dry asap
